Add User Access Reporting for Product Entitlements and Permissions

Administrators need a supported UI-based reporting capability in Data Product Hub to list which users have access to which products for audit purposes.

Currently, administrators need a consolidated view that shows user access across products, services, and platform capabilities. The report should identify the users who have access, the products they can access, the roles or permissions assigned, and whether access is granted directly or inherited through group membership.

This information is required to support audit reviews, access validation, and periodic user access certification activities. Without a centralized UI report, administrators may need to manually review users, groups, roles, and product-level access across multiple areas, which increases administrative effort and may result in incomplete audit evidence.

The requested enhancement is to provide a built-in UI report in Data Product Hub that allows administrators to generate and export user access information for audit purposes.

The report should include, where available:

  • User name or user ID

  • Email address

  • Products the user can access

  • Assigned role or permission level

  • Whether access is directly assigned or inherited through group membership

  • Group name granting access, if applicable

  • User status, such as active or inactive

  • Last login or last activity date

  • Export capability for audit evidence

The report should be accessible through the Data Product Hub UI and should support filtering or searching by user, product, role, group, access type, and user status. Export options such as CSV or Excel would help administrators provide evidence during internal and external audits.

This enhancement would improve audit readiness, simplify access reviews, reduce manual administrative work, and provide clearer visibility into who has access to which products in Data Product Hub.
